Understanding Haematococcus Pluvialis and Astaxanthin
Haematococcus pluvialis is a microalgae that thrives in freshwater environments. When subjected to stress, such as intense sunlight or nutrient scarcity, it produces astaxanthin, a red pigment and a highly potent antioxidant. Astaxanthin is what gives salmon, flamingos, and shrimp their distinctive pinkish hue. Its antioxidant properties are what make Haematococcus pluvialis a sought-after ingredient in skincare.
The Antioxidant Power of Astaxanthin
Astaxanthin is often hailed as the king of carotenoids due to its exceptional ability to neutralize free radicals. Studies have shown that astaxanthin is significantly more powerful than other antioxidants like vitamin E, beta-carotene, and lutein. This makes it an excellent natural defense against oxidative stress, which is a major contributor to skin aging and damage.

Combatting Inflammation and Redness
One of the primary benefits of astaxanthin is its anti-inflammatory properties. By reducing inflammation, Haematococcus pluvialis can help soothe irritated skin, reduce redness, and promote a more even skin tone.
Protecting Against UV Damage
Exposure to UV rays is one of the leading causes of skin damage. Astaxanthin has been shown to help protect the skin from the harmful effects of UV radiation, thereby preventing sunburn, photoaging, and the risk of skin cancer.
Improving Skin Elasticity and Moisture
With its potent antioxidant properties, astaxanthin from Haematococcus pluvialis can help improve skin elasticity and moisture retention. This results in firmer, plumper skin with fewer fine lines and wrinkles.
Scientific Evidence and Case Studies
Several studies have highlighted the skin benefits of astaxanthin. For instance, a 2012 study published in the journal “Acta Biochimica Polonica” found that astaxanthin could significantly improve skin condition in all layers, including the corneocyte layer and the epidermis. Another study in the “Journal of Cosmetic Dermatology” reported that astaxanthin could enhance skin elasticity and reduce the appearance of fine lines.
